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kintore to Woolwich Dockyard start from as little as £63.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Kintore to Woolwich Dockyard start from £113.60 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kintore to Woolwich Dockyard are available for £237.40 one way

Facilities and Accessibility at Kintore

Kintore Train Station ensures a hassle-free travel experience despite not having a ticket office. Travelers can utilize the ticket machines available for buying and collecting tickets, with accessible ticket machines ensuring everyone can use them effortlessly. The induction loop system further supports those with hearing impairments. Although there is a lack of staff assistance on-site, the customer help points can offer guidance if needed.

Emphasizing accessibility, the entire station boasts step-free access, making it simple for passengers with mobility challenges to navigate. There are 12 accessible parking spaces available in the station's car park with CCTV surveillance, ensuring your vehicle's safety while you explore. While there are no refreshment or shop facilities, the practical design focuses on what truly matters: getting you to your destination quickly and securely.

Onward Travel from Kintore

Kintore Train Station is seamlessly integrated into the local transport network. For bus enthusiasts, a convenient stop is located just 300 meters outside the station on the B987. Those requiring taxi services can find detailed information at TrainTaxi. If your travel plans extend to international skies, Dyce Station is approximately nine miles away from Aberdeen Airport, offering a gateway to the world.

Essential Facilities and Amenities

Woolwich Dockyard station provides several key amenities to ensure a smooth travel experience. The ticket office operates only during weekday mornings, opening from 06:40 to 13:25, yet fear not if you travel outside these hours. The station is equipped with accessible ticket machines located by the entrance to platform 1, offering travelers the flexibility to purchase or collect pre-purchased tickets at their convenience.

For those needing additional assistance, the station includes an accessible ticket machine and induction loop, enhancing the experience for travelers with disabilities. Offering a reasonable degree of step-free access, particularly towards services traveling away from London, the station is marked as a Category B3 for accessibility. Nonetheless, important to note, platform 1, used for services toward London, remains inaccessible without stairs, which could be a consideration for some travelers.

Onward Travel Options

Traveling from or toward Woolwich Dockyard station opens up a multitude of transport links. Thanks to its connection to local bus services, you can easily journey onwards to Charlton, Dartford, or other nearby locales. Rail replacement services operate at designated bus stops on Frances Street, ensuring continuity of your travel even when train services are disrupted.
